Tracy managed a project for a publishing company. her team worked with a college professor to publish a new math textbook. which

scenario illustrates a resource risk?
Business
1 answer:
Semenov [28]2 years ago
4 0

The scenario that  illustrates a resource risk when Tracy managed a project for a publishing company is option D. The copy editor for the textbook becomes seriously ill, so Tracy must hire a new copy editor.

<h3>What is resource risk ?</h3>

A resource risk  can be described as a  chance that  is been assumed that someone  will fail to meet a goal as a result of lack of resources.

This is because the Resources can i encompass the financing, time, skilled workers and  what is  needed to achieve a particular goal, hence scenario that  illustrates a resource risk when Tracy managed a project for a publishing company is  copy editor for the textbook becomes seriously ill, so Tracy must hire a new copy editor.

The option for the question are :

A. The author thought that the publishing team would create the end-of-chapter questions and answers.

B. The original estimate for binding the books was two weeks. The bindery informs Tracy that it will take three weeks to complete the binding process.

C. The professor refuses to approve the cover of the book.

D. The copy editor for the textbook becomes seriously ill, so Tracy must hire a new copy editor.

What action involves reconfiguring or redesigning work, jobs, and processes for the purpose of improving cost, quality, service,
katrin2010 [14]

Answer:

b. Reengineering

Explanation:

Business Process Reengineering or Business Process Redesign (BPR) involves radical overhaul of company's core business processes, work, jobs, etc to achieve radical performance improvement in terms of quality of service, cost reduction, productivity etc. Company's start from zero and re-think all the processes.

<em>Restructuring:</em> It is significant change made to operational process or structure of a company when the company is facing financial pressure.

For Example Debt Restructuring involves change in terms of debt and creating a way to pay off debt.

<em>Downsizing:</em> Downsizing involves terminating multiple employees at the same time to save money.

<em>Delayering:</em> It is a way to remove one or more levels of hierarchy from the organisational structure. It is a way to flatten the organisation's structure.

<em>Recruiting:</em> It is process of finding and hiring the qualified and suitable people for a given job.

Customers who face the same general needs of the marketplace but are likely to experience them months or years earlier than the
inn [45]

Answer:

Letter B is correct. <em>Lead Users</em>.

Explanation:

Term developed by prof. Eric von Hippel, Lead Users are those users who are able to transform, adapt and modify a company's product or service for their own benefit, as they face the same market needs a while before regular users.

For Prof Eric von Hippel, there are four steps in developing Lead Users:

  1. Preparation,
  2. Needs and Trends Identification,
  3. Lead Users Identification, and
  4. Concept Design.

The premise is that the Lead Users method is effective in identifying innovation and product trends that need to be developed for a market for your needs.
